About Kerry Withers
Kerry Withers is a scholar working on Equine, General Dentistry and Conservation, having authored 13 papers that have together received 421 indexed citations. Recurring topics across this work include Adipose Tissue and Metabolism (6 papers), Physiological and biochemical adaptations (5 papers) and Mitochondrial Function and Pathology (2 papers). The work is most often cited by research in Physiology (268 citations), Aging (16 citations) and Ecology (167 citations). Kerry Withers has collaborated with scholars based in Australia, Germany and United States. Frequent co-authors include A. J. Hulbert, Martin D. Brand, Paul L. Else, Patrice Couture, Martin Jastroch, Martin Klingenspor, Peter B. Frappell, Bronwyn M. McAllan, Gerhard Heldmaier and Conrad Sernia. Their work appears in journals such as Biochemical Journal, Proceedings of the Royal Society B Biological Sciences and Food & Function.
